The Nokia N95 which has been one of the most awaited mobile phone, is coming up with a 8GB storage version. The currently available Nokia N95 is capable of connecting to mobile Broadband using WLAN or HSDPA (3.5G). You can find directions using the integrated GPS, take photos using the 5 megapixel autofocus camera and enjoy music and videos.
The Nokia N95 is a GSM/WCDMA dual mode mobile phone that supports EGSM 850/900/1800/1900 and WCDMA 2100 HSDPA. It has a 2.6†240 x 320 pixels, 16M color display and can be connected to a compatible TV using direct TV out or via Wireless LAN and UPnP technology. Additional connectivity of the Nokia N95 include USB 2.0, Bluetooth 2.0 EDR with A2DP stereo audio and is capable of providing extra storage using a MicroSD memory card.
